A Chilling Mystery That Keeps You Hooked

Charlaine Harris, best known for her Sookie Stackhouse series, delivers another compelling paranormal mystery with An Ice Cold Grave, the third installment in the Harper Connelly series. With an impressive 3.96 average rating from over 36,000 readers on Goodreads, this novel proves Harris's skill at blending supernatural elements with gripping detective work.

What Makes This Book Special?

Unlike typical crime novels, An Ice Cold Grave features Harper Connelly, a unique protagonist who can locate dead bodies and sense their final moments. This extraordinary ability adds an intriguing layer to the investigative process, setting it apart from conventional mysteries. Readers consistently praise how Harris uses this paranormal element to enhance rather than overwhelm the story.

The novel finds Harper and her stepbrother Tolliver investigating a series of disappearances in a small North Carolina town. What begins as a routine case soon unfolds into something far more sinister. Harris masterfully builds tension while keeping the story accessible - a balance that both adult and young adult readers can appreciate.

Why Readers Love It

Fans of the series highlight several standout qualities:

  • Engaging protagonist: Harper's vulnerability and strength make her relatable despite her unusual gift
  • Atmospheric setting: The wintry small-town backdrop adds to the eerie tone
  • Well-paced mystery: The plot unfolds with just the right balance of clues and surprises
  • Character dynamics: The evolving relationship between Harper and Tolliver adds depth without dominating the story

At 280 pages, the novel moves briskly while providing satisfying character development. Harris's straightforward prose makes complex emotions and situations understandable without oversimplifying, a quality that resonates with both casual readers and mystery enthusiasts.
